Eurovision 2021: Semi-final one line-up
The 16 semi-final one acts range from old school pop bops to modern dramatic ballads. We’ve got quirky disco and dramatic chansons. Gospel, hyper pop and dream pop all feature. However, only ten of the 16 will make it out of the 20 May semi-final and into the grand final.
First half
- Australia: Montaigne “Technicolour”
- Ireland: Lesley Roy “Maps”
- Lithuania: The Roop “Discoteque”
- North Macedonia: Vasil “Here I Stand”
- Russia: Manizha “Russian Woman”
- Slovenia: Ana Soklič “Amen”
- Sweden: Tusse “Voices”
Second half
- Azerbaijan: Efendi “Mata Hari”
- Belgium: Hooverphonic “The Wrong Place”
- Croatia: Albina “Tick-Tock”
- Cyprus: Elena Tsagrinou “El Diablo”
- Israel: Eden Alene “Set Me Free”
- Malta: Destiny “Je me cases”
- Norway: Tix “Fallen Angel”
- Romania: Roxen “Amnesia”
- Ukraine: Go_A “Shum”
